2.11.28 Rudder Angle
Menu Heading:
MISC
Function Text:
RUDDER
Update Rate:
Once per second
Units:
Degrees
Notes
1. Requires rudder angle sensor.
2. Offset calibration available.
This function is used to indicate to the Trimmers how well the boat is
balanced.
2.11.29 Sea Temperature
Menu Heading:
TEMP
Function Text:
SEA TEMP
Update Rate:
Once per second
Units:
Degrees Centigrade/Fahrenheit
Notes
1. Requires temperature sensor.
2. Audible high/low alarm available.
Useful on long distance sailing when ocean currents are discerned by
changes in water temperature. It can be useful in other ways too. Often the
water flowing out of rivers differs in temperature quite markedly to the sea,
and this may help you pick up the favourable current.
